About this home

Fantastic opportunity at the iconic The Esplanade. Available immediately. This beautifully renovated 800+ sf 1-bedroom + den suite offers exceptional value in one of downtown Toronto's most established and well-managed buildings. Freshly painted and recently updated throughout with a brand new kitchen featuring new appliances, stone countertops, backsplash, and cabinetry, backsplash and a fully renovated bathroom, plus new flooring in the entry and kitchen. Truly move-in ready. Thoughtfully laid out with no wasted space, this functional floor plan offers a spacious primary bedroom, oversized living and dining area perfect for entertaining, and a generous den that works beautifully as a home office, guest room, or easy potential second bedroom conversion. Enjoy 24/7 concierge, excellent amenities, and an upscale, mature building community in an unbeatable AAA location. Steps to Union Station, the PATH, Scotiabank Arena, St. Lawrence Market, the Financial District, waterfront, TTC, GO, shops, restaurants, and everything downtown Toronto has to offer. A rare opportunity to own in a landmark building in the heart of the city.

Mortgage stress test

6.14%Qualifying rate
$3,500/monthPayment at the qualifying rate

Lenders qualify you at the greater of your rate plus 2% or 5.25%. You do not pay this rate. It just shows you could still handle payments if rates rose, so aim to stay comfortable at this higher number.
